/etc/network/interfaces 파일 확인

/etc/network/interfaces 파일 확인

/etc/network/interfaces.NET을 설치하기 전에 sudo를 확인하는 /etc/network/interfaces/*.conf방법 과 유사하게 구문이나 파일을 확인하는 데 사용할 수 있는 도구가 Linux에 내장되어 있습니까?visudo

저는 이전의 "사물 인터넷이지만 그렇지 않을 가능성이 높습니다"에 배포할 스크립트 방법을 작성 중이며 구성 생성기를 단위 테스트하고 싶습니다.

답변1

ifup --no-act --interfaces=/home/user/interfaces.new eth0시작된 인터페이스에서 이 명령을 사용하여 지정된 인터페이스 파일에 구문 오류가 있는지 확인할 수 있습니다.

오류가 있는 경우 오류 줄 번호와 인터페이스 파일을 구문 분석할 수 없다는 정보를 나타내는 메시지를 받게 됩니다.

오류가 없으면 인터페이스가 구성되었다는 메시지를 받게 됩니다.

$?스크립트에서 명령을 실행한 후 변수 값을 보면 명령의 반환 값을 확인할 수 있습니다.

추가 man ifup정보.

관련 정보